Zcash (ZEC) Price Shows Strength With Technical Signals Hinting $480 Break

  • Zcash (ZEC) records short term bounce amid broader weakness.
  • Weekly performance still reflects sustained selling pressure.
  • Rising volume signals active but cautious market participation.
  • Technical indicators advise patience over aggressive positioning.

Zcash (ZEC) is showing a brief recovery even as the broader weekly trend remains weak. The token climbed around 1.14% in the past day, pointing to fresh demand. Still, the past week tells a softer story, with ZEC down about 5.74% overall.

At the time of writing, ZEC is trading at $395.32, and trading activity has picked up. Daily volume totals roughly $815.51 million, up 22.63% over the past 24 hours. Its market value stands at $6.5 billion, marking a mild 1.16% rise over 24 hours.

Key Support and Resistance Levels Breakdown

On the 4-hour chart, ZEC shows a clear shift from a rising channel into corrective price action. A sharp rejection near 460–480 broke the bullish structure and pushed the price below trend support. Sellers now control momentum, with price capped under $395–$405 and broader resistance stacked at $420–$430.

The current consolidation forms a descending wedge, which remains bearish until proven otherwise. The Price is hovering around $360–$370, a weak short-term support zone aligned with the 0.382 Fib. Failure here opens downside continuation toward the $320–$300 target range, which is highlighted as the primary demand area.

 If the selling pressure speeds up, a stronger decline may target as low as $247 around the 0.618 Fib, which represents extremely bearish support. For a bullish invalidation, a clean breakout through $405 is necessary, and further acceptance above the $420-$430 levels is needed. Only then will a rally to $460-$480 levels be technically feasible.

RSI and MACD reflect cooling momentum

The RSI for the week is seen at 59, having eased from the overbought position above 70. The slight decline in RSI indicates deteriorating bullish sentiments, but it does not confirm a bear market. RSI above 50 indicates that buying pressure is dominating the markets; however, the relative strength has dwindled in the past few weeks.

The MACD is still positive, as the MACD line remains above the signal line. However, the histogram is getting smaller, which means the bullish momentum is slowing down. Such a scenario often occurs right before a deeper correction, unless a new wave of buying momentum boosts the histogram.

First family moves on from Wall Street as Eric Trump backs crypto

First family moves on from Wall Street as Eric Trump backs crypto

Eric Trump says crypto could actually save the U.S. dollar. Not kill it. Not weaken it. On Tuesday, just hours after ringing the Nasdaq opening bell for American Bitcoin’s public debut, a company where he’s got over $500 million stashed, Eric told the Financial Times that crypto is “arguably” the reason the dollar might stay alive. “Mining bitcoin here, and being financially independent and running a kind of financial revolution out of the United States of America…I think it arguably saves the US dollar,” he said. The timing wasn’t random. Eric’s comments came while the dollar was getting dragged. This year, it’s been tanking… fast. The cause? President Donald Trump’s trade war and his endless public jabs at the Federal Reserve, which just slashed interest rates again. The Fed cut rates yesterday, for the first time this year, right after Donald’s latest round of pressure. It’s not helping. Investors are losing confidence in what’s supposed to be the safest currency on Earth. Eric says crypto is fun, family is done with Wall Street Eric isn’t just pushing crypto from the sidelines. His family has gone full throttle into the space. We’re talking a Truth Social Bitcoin ETF, a Bitcoin treasury tied to Trump Media, and two meme coins; $MELANIA and $TRUMP. Eric defended both coins, saying they were meant to be “fun,” and explained why people are buying in: “They want to bet on a coin, or they want to bet on a player. They want to bet on a celebrity, or they want to bet on a famous brand. Or they just love somebody to death, and they want to buy, you know, a kind of small piece of them, via digital currency.” And Eric doesn’t give Wall Street any credit. At all. He made it clear that everything they’ve built was done without the help of big-name banks. “It’s almost like the ultimate revenge against the big banks and modern finance,” he said. That jab came after the Trump Organization filed a lawsuit against Capital One, accusing the bank of closing their accounts in 2021 for political reasons — something the bank denies. But Eric wasn’t done. “You realise you just don’t need them. And frankly, you don’t miss them.” He added that he wasn’t just referring to Capital One, but “all” of Wall Street’s major lenders and their “top people.” Stablecoins, trillions, and the White House betting on crypto Stablecoins have traditional banks spooked. They think cash might flow out of the banking system if coins like Tether or Circle offer better returns. And that fear isn’t fake. It’s growing, especially after Congress passed the first major crypto law in July. Now the White House wants stablecoin issuers to buy up a fat slice of the Treasury’s debt. Why? Because these crypto firms make money on the interest from the bonds they hold. Last year, Eric co-founded World Liberty Financial Inc. (WLFI), a crypto company that runs a stablecoin called USD1, pegged to the U.S. dollar. That project has serious family backing. Donald held 15.75 billion WLFI tokens at the end of 2024, based on official filings. At Wednesday’s trading price, that holding was worth over $3 billion.
